Rule 2-22

Hurdling is an attempt by a player to jump (hurdle) with one or both feet or
knees foremost over an opponent who is contacting the ground with no part of
his body except one or both feet.
I love the definitions most coaches and officiials dont spend enough time in Rule 2. In the play posted the feet or knees were not foremost
fore·most adj \-ˌmōst\
Definition of FOREMOST
1: first in a series or progression
2: of first rank or position : preeminent

So no foul just a great play
